A processor has
failed, or it is not
seated properly.
1. Remove a single processor.
2. Reseat the processor firmly.
3. If this does not solve the problem, replace with a known good
processor to identify the failed component.
4. If a processor failed, verify that the correct heatsink and thermal
pad were installed and always use a new thermal pad when
replacing a processor or heatsink.
NOTE: Run RBSU to reset a processor fail status after reseating or
replacing a processor.

A memory
module has
failed, or it is not
seated properly.
1. Reseat the memory module firmly.
2. If this does not solve the problem, replace with a known good
memory module to identify the failed component.
